If the car doesnt turns over
1)check the clutch switch
If the car turns over
2)check the fuel pump fuse
3)Open up the underhood fuse box and place your finger on the PWR/TRN relay and have some one turn the ignition on, You should feel this relay energize.
The inj fuse is fed from it.
For the power steering check the EPS fuse 60 amps
Also the Emiss fuse

Okay check the 50 amp fuse in the trunk near the battery.
Its a inline fuse that protects the feed to the Bcm.
